Promotion history and records

Students remember the exact class they got their blue belt; MatPilot keeps a matching audit trail.

Viewing a member's promotion history

Open the member's profile, Ranks tab. You'll see a chronological timeline of every rank change, including:

  • Date
  • Art
  • From rank, to rank
  • Instructor name
  • Diploma link (if generated)

What members see

Members can see their full promotion history in the Progress section of their own app. This is one of the most motivating screens, seeing the journey from white belt to their current rank laid out in order.

Instructor attribution

When a promotion is recorded, the logged-in user (owner or instructor) is credited as the promoting instructor. For a Graduation Day ceremony, that credit goes to whoever taps Apply after the event, so make sure the right person is logged in when you do.

The promotion record format

Each record stores a snapshot of the exact data at the time of promotion: member name, belt, date, gym name. This means the record stays accurate even if you later change the gym name or the member updates their own name.

Cannot be edited or deleted

Promotion records are immutable by design. If you made an error, correct the member's current belt using the Set belt option on their Ranks tab, the incorrect promotion stays in history for the record. For anything more serious, contact MatPilot support.
